The revamped password reset flow in the Lockstone API replaces emailed links with short-lived reset grants. Plugins initiate a reset by posting the account handle to the reset endpoint, then poll the grant status until the user confirms out-of-band. Grants expire after ten minutes and are single-use; a consumed grant returns a terminal status rather than an error. All reset endpoints require plugin-level authentication via the bearer token shown below.

bearer token for yajop-tahop: eyJhbGciOiJIUzI1NiIsInR5cCI6IkpXVCJ9.eyJzdWIiOiIC9r503In0.M9JwY-EN

# Limits & Quotas: Velvetine Query Planner Regression

After release 4.2, the Velvetine planner began choosing nested-loop joins for queries previously served by hash joins, inflating execution time and, relevantly for security review, making resource-exhaustion abuse easier. We mitigated by tightening per-query limits rather than reverting, since the revert reopens a separate privilege-check gap. Quotas are enforced at admission time and cannot be raised by tenant configuration. The enforced limits introduced by the mitigation are as follows.

limits module of tahof-tawig:
WEIGHTS = {
    "fenwyn": 285,
    "briiel": 528,
    "druiel": 1023,
    "kasax": 747,
    "jordor": 334,
}

The garage occupancy feed for the Brindlewood campus arrives over a message queue every thirty seconds, one record per level, published by the Stallgrid edge boxes. Counts can briefly go negative when a sensor double-fires on exit; the ingest job clamps these to zero and flags the interval. If the feed stalls for more than five minutes, the dashboard falls back to the last known snapshot. Sensor mappings, queue names, and the replay procedure are documented on the internal page below.

runbook for tahog-kadug: https://gitlab.qirvanworks.corp/projects/pages/view/b139298aed28